The Atlanta Hawks (5-17) will be at home in Philips Arena when they go head-to-head with the Brooklyn Nets (8-14). The games Over/Under (O/U) opened at 217.5 points with Atlanta set as a 2-point favorite. Action begins at 7:30 p.m. ET on Monday, December 4, 2017, and it can be seen on YES Network.

Brooklyn Nets at Atlanta Hawks Odds Preview

These two teams have already met twice this year, each winning once. Dinwiddie recorded 15 points, nine assists and six rebounds in the most recent matchup, in which the Nets lost 114-102, unable to cover as 4.5-point favorites. The two teams combined for 216 points, which was just 1 points below the projected point total of 217 points. The Hawks dominated nearly every facet of the game. They had a ridiculously low turnover percentage of 7.1 and a superb offensive rebounding percentage of 27.7. The Nets were 17.2 and 26.1, respectively, for those same stats. It will be a matchup of contrasting styles as the up-and-down Nets (ranked third in the NBA in possessions per game) will look to push the more grind-it-out Hawks (13th in possessions per game). Of Brooklyn’s 22 games, 13 have finished over the projected point total, while 11 of Atlanta’s 22 games have finished over the projected point total. The Nets come into this game with a substantial advantage in both straight up (SU) and against the spread (ATS) records. They are 8-14 SU and 14-8 ATS, while the Hawks are 5-17 SU and 10-11-1 ATS.
